Transaction 21011a81af81be167300bca894e104084b2acdb76c756fd49e44e416a77e43c2

1 Input
2 Outputs
  • 21011a81af81be167300bca894e104084b2acdb76c756fd49e44e416a77e43c2:0
  • value  3779646
    address  35oichB1dQ4yHJz6BmbzbLGu1ZjLdRQ3wq
  • 21011a81af81be167300bca894e104084b2acdb76c756fd49e44e416a77e43c2:1
  • value  135675971
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p